(L.A.) Juan Paolo Tantoco, 44, Died From Overdosing on Coke
Case Number: 2025-04377
Los Angeles County is reporting the death of a 44-year-old Asian male that occurred at the Beverly Hilton Hotel, located at 9876 Wilshire Boulevard in Beverly Hills.
The coroner’s office identified the man as Juan Paolo Tantoco.
Manner of Death: Accident
Cause of Death: Cocaine Effects
Other Significant Condition: Probable Atherosclerotic Cardiovascular Disease
RIP JUAN PAOLO TANTOCO (January 6, 1981 – March 8, 2025)
Formal pronouncement of death was made on Saturday at 12:05 p.m.
Ruling by the deputy medical examiner was published on July 9, presumably after the results of tox screening had come back from the lab. This is considered an accidental, i.e., unintentional, drug overdose.
The decedent was a Filipino business executive who was part of the family known for owning the Rustan’s retail chain in their home country. He was in the United States apparently as part of the entourage of Liza Araneta-Marcos, First Lady of the Philippines, who was promoting the Manila International Film Festival in Hollywood from March 4 to 7. The MIFF’s tribute gala was held on March 7 at The Beverly Hilton. His body has been repatriated.
It is not the LAPD, but the Beverly Hills Police Department, that has jurisdiction in this area.
Paolo Tantoco is survived by his wife Dina Arroyo and their three children.
